Multiple Tips Identify 16-Year-Old Murder Victim, Suspect on the Run

In June 2021, skeletal remains were discovered along County Road 225 in Wharton County, a rural area southwest of Houston, Texas. The Wharton County Sheriff’s Office, along with other law enforcement agencies, responded to the scene and launched an investigation. The remains were determined to belong to a teenage...

Michelin Guide honors three Texas restaurants with new star ratings

The Michelin Guide honored three more Texas restaurants with its one-star rating Tuesday night at a ceremony in Houston. Last November, the Michelin Guide announced its first-ever Texas restaurant list, awarding 15 Lone Star State restaurants with a one-star rating. Since starting in 1900 as a means to promote the...

1607 Klauke St., Rosenberg purchased by Wendy and Kristy Phillips and Karen Phillips Youngblood

The home at 1607 Klauke St., Rosenberg was sold on Oct. 24 by Louise L. Goates Phillips for $37,183. The buyers were Wendy and Kristy Phillips and Karen Phillips Youngblood. The property tax paid for this property in 2020 was $161. This is 0.4% of the assessed value of the home.
